WebBeginning in the late 1800s, numerous sequoia groves in an area that would later become the parks, and in the neighboring Sequoia National Forest, were logged. Big Stump Grove, near the entrance to Kings Canyon National Park, is worth a visit for those interested in exploring the site of the Smith-Comstock Mill and logging camp. WebUpper Stony Creek Campground is between Kings Canyon and Sequoia National Parks, just off the General’s Highway. The campground has 23 sites, vault toilets, and drinking water. It sits at 6,400 feet and offers tremendous access to the hiking trails in the Jennie Lake Wilderness. WebJul 22, 2024 · Address GPS: 36.8592, -119.096802. Management: National Forest Service.
